    Lumberjacks is a small chain of eight restaurants, with seven of them located in Northern California, and a lone outpost located in Las Vegas. The name fits the restaurant, as the generous portions will keep a lumberjack, along with a football linebacker, full and happy. [[HIGHLIGHT]]Can you say "rustic?" ... rustic is the word for the decor of the restaurant, as the decor revolves around a lumberjack theme.[[ENDHIGHLIGHT]] The decor is rustic, the cuisine is "Diner Americana," but [[HIGHLIGHT]]the dining room is inviting, clean and comfortable.[[ENDHIGHLIGHT]] [[HIGHLIGHT]]The dining room carries out the rustic, lumberjack theme, as it's decorated with faux logs and wood paneling, which enhances the atmosphere.[[ENDHIGHLIGHT]] [[HIGHLIGHT]]Period photos, along with state-of-the-art video monitors decorate the walls.[[ENDHIGHLIGHT]] Love it!! From the "Weekday Specials" menu, I went with a New York steak, hashbrown potatoes, fried eggs, sourdough toast, and an optional side of breakfast. Yowza!!! My last breakfast of 2024 turned out to be one of the best breakfasts that I'd the pleasure to enjoy during the entire year. Thanks to Ashley, Lindsay and the friendly and talented staff at Lumberjacks, located in Grass Valley. The "Weekday Specials" aren't listed on the menu, nor are they posted on a chalk board, and they're offered to you by your server, as you're greeted at your table. Yes, I looked over the menu, but a New York steak breakfast, cooked to order, sounded out like a great way to say adios to 2024. As per my order, my steak arrived cooked medium rare, complete with attractive grill marks. As explained by my server, the steak was "breakfast sized" around 6-oz or so... but size didn't matter, as this steak was not only attractive to look at, but it was seasoned, juicy, tender and simply delicious. Lumberjacks is a well kept secret for gold country dining, as they make a superior breakfast steak! My side of choice was hashbrown potatoes, and I made a superior choice, as these hashbrowns were some of the best I've ever enjoyed in Nevada County dining! The potatoes were shredded - naturally - and fried to a perfect golden brown, crispy on the outside, and tender on the inside, which made for some of the most perfect hashbrowns that you could ever imagine. The two eggs were fried as per my order, sunnyside up, which works well with hashbrown potatoes. Two slices of sourdough toast were perfectly toasted, buttered, and worked with the breakfast. The optional side of breakfast gravy really added "the period to the sentence," as it was thick, creamy, with chunky sausage and simply delicious. I alternated between dipping bits of steak and potato into the gravy... whatever the case, it made for an amazing add-on to enhance this superior breakfast. Happy New Year... well... almost, but the check for this amazing breakfast came to... get this... $12.79! That's right... steak, eggs, and an optional side of gravy. I was dazzled, amazed and shocked... as I expected well on the high side of $20.00. My dining experience on this last day of 2024 was simply amazing! Lindsay and Ashley treated my like family, and I enjoyed a "New York Steak of the Century" breakfast, to "ace out" the year 2024, which has been a fantastic year for Gold Country Dining. Nevada County dining at the finest... Lumberjacks... located in Grass Valley, CA! As the menu reads... "Where the big boys eat..." And... if I may add... it's FIVE STAR DINING!!!!
